Transaction 70786dbe7a9f3e820f91aeb4b6cb9ea2282ae4d7e457e858c655b666604ad834
1 Input
2 Outputs
- 70786dbe7a9f3e820f91aeb4b6cb9ea2282ae4d7e457e858c655b666604ad834:0
- 70786dbe7a9f3e820f91aeb4b6cb9ea2282ae4d7e457e858c655b666604ad834:1
value 308866
address 3DiN5dPCDMecUcxRXCrmWjB29D8exdfUqo
value 4033788
address 141yMZzZ72bA4dYpmzUs8a2aGNfNeA4opE